Philippines - Yield of Peanut

Since 2015, Philippines Yield of Peanut remained stable. At 1.16 Metric Tons Per Hectare in 2020, the country was number 27 comparing other countries in Yield of Peanut. Nicaragua lead the ranking with 4.5 Metric Tons Per Hectare in 2020, that is a growth of 0.2% compared to 2019. United States, Argentina and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Zimbabwe recorded the best 5 years average growth at +8% per year, while Chad witnessed the worst performance at -2.5% per year.
